Prairie County's estimated 2025 population is 7,954 with a growth rate of -0.51% in the past year according to the most recent United States census data. Prairie County is the 66th largest county in Arkansas. The 2010 population was 8,726 and has seen a growth of -8.85% since that time.

The racial composition of Prairie County includes 84.66% White, 10.5% Black or African American, and smaller percentages for other race, Native American and multiracial populations.
Race | Population | Percentage (of total) |
---|---|---|
White | 6,910 | 84.66% |
Black or African American | 857 | 10.5% |
Two or more races | 321 | 3.93% |
Other race | 67 | 0.82% |
Native American | 7 | 0.09% |

Prairie County's average per capita income is $38,394. Household income levels show a median of $51,094. The poverty rate stands at 9.37%.
Name | Median | Mean |
---|---|---|
Married Families | $86,815 | - |
Families | $80,865 | $96,667 |
Households | $51,094 | $75,028 |
Non Families | $26,455 | $38,643 |
